JSP登陆注册增删改查过滤器
【JSP登陆注册增删改查过滤器】是Web开发中的一个重要组成部分,主要涉及JavaServer Pages(JSP)技术,用户身份验证,数据库操作以及HTTP请求的过滤处理。以下是对这些知识点的详细解释: 1. **JSP(JavaServer Pages)**:JSP是一种动态网页技术,它允许开发者在HTML或XML文档中嵌入Java代码,从而实现服务器端的业务逻辑处理。JSP文件会被服务器转换成Servlet,然后由Servlet引擎执行。在"登陆注册"场景中,JSP通常用于构建用户界面,处理表单提交,并展示反馈信息。 2. **用户登录注册**:这是Web应用的基本功能,涉及用户账户的创建、验证和认证。登录过程通常包括用户输入用户名和密码,然后服务器通过比较存储的凭证来验证用户身份。注册过程则需要收集用户信息,如用户名、密码(可能需要加密存储)、邮箱等,保存到数据库中。在JSP中,这通常涉及到HTTP请求的处理,以及与后端服务(如Servlet或Spring MVC控制器)的交互。 3. **用户增删改查**:在数据库管理中,CRUD(Create, Read, Update, Delete)是基本操作。在JSP应用中,用户信息的管理通常通过后台数据库实现。创建新用户意味着插入新记录,读取用户信息涉及查询操作,更新用户资料是修改记录,而删除用户则需要删除对应的数据库记录。这些操作通常由服务器端的Java代码处理,例如使用JDBC(Java Database Connectivity)进行数据库操作。 4. **过滤器(Filter)**:在Java Web应用中,过滤器是Servlet规范的一部分,它可以在请求到达目标Servlet或JSP之前对其进行拦截和处理。过滤器常用于身份验证、数据校验、字符编码转换、日志记录等。在“JSP登陆注册”中,过滤器可以用来检查用户是否已登录,如果未登录,则重定向到登录页面,或者在每次请求前检查用户的权限。 5. **TestUser2012.3.10PM**:这个文件名可能是测试用户数据或示例代码的名称,表明在开发过程中用于模拟用户数据的文件。这可能包含一些预设的用户账号信息,用于测试登录、注册和用户管理功能。 "JSP登陆注册增删改查过滤器"是一个涵盖Web应用基础功能的实例,涉及到前端与后端的交互,用户身份验证,数据库操作,以及HTTP请求的过滤。理解和掌握这些知识点对于开发高效、安全的Web应用至关重要。
- 1
- ann8552014-05-06好多叉号啊,不晓得怎么修改nature_fly0882016-05-31需要重新配置下JDK就可以了
- 粉丝: 47
- 资源: 28
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助